Slow Cooker Chicken Thighs With A Caramelized Honey-Gold Butter Glaze

Succulent Slow Cooker Chicken Thighs featuring a deep golden-brown caramelized honey glaze, charred edges, and a shimmering butter sauce. A restaurant-quality meal made easy with fall-apart tender meat and vibrant fresh herbs.
Prep Time 15 minutes
Cook Time 4 hours 10 minutes
Total Time 4 hours 25 minutes
Servings: 4 people
Course: Dinner, Main Course
Cuisine: American
Calories: 420

Ingredients
  

Recipe Ingredients
  • 2 lbs (900g) Bone-in, skin-on chicken thighs Patted dry
  • 4 tbsp (60g) Unsalted butter Melted
  • 1/3 cup (80ml) Wildflower honey
  • 1 tbsp (2g) Dried herb flakes Oregano and thyme mix
  • 1.5 tsp (4g) Cracked black pepper Coarse
  • 1/2 cup (15g) Fresh curly parsley Finely chopped

Equipment

  • 1 6-quart Slow Cooker Ensures even cooking in a single layer.
  • 1 Cast Iron Skillet Essential for achieving the caramelized, charred edges.

Method
 

Slow Cooking Phase
  1. Place dry chicken thighs in the slow cooker. Whisk melted butter, honey, garlic powder, and dried herbs, then pour over chicken to coat.
  2. Cook on LOW for 4-5 hours until the meat is tender and has reached an internal temperature of 165°F (74°C).
The Perfect Finish
  1. Remove chicken and pour the remaining liquid into a saucepan. Simmer until it forms a thick honey-gold glaze.
  2. Place chicken skin-side down in a hot skillet for 3-4 minutes until a deep golden-brown crust and charred edges form.
  3. Arrange on a platter, drizzle with reduced butter sauce, and garnish with fresh curly parsley and cracked pepper.

Notes

Use a heavy skillet for the sear to ensure the chicken doesn't stick.
Always pat the chicken skin dry before adding to the slow cooker to help the fat render.
